The Professional’s Guide to CPU Usage. Tools and Techniques for Peak Performance

Since technologies influencing every part of our lives, computer performance is an essential component of any career. CPU efficiency is crucial for achieving best outcomes in any field, whether you work in IT, perform computationally heavy jobs, or process big volumes of data. As a result, you should have a solid understanding of CPU utilization and how to optimize it for better system performance.













Image Credit: Depositphotos

Tools for Monitoring and Optimizing CPU Utilization

CPU consumption indicates how many CPU resources the system is using to complete activities at any one time. Monitoring this metric allows you to not only track performance, but also discover potential issues. Those that affect computer performance. For many, one of the key questions is what is a good CPU utilization. That is, what should be the normal processor load for optimal performance.


The question of Mac CPU utilization often arises among users who are faced with excessive CPU load. If your Mac has started to run slower, be sure to check which apps are consuming the most resources. There are several ways how to check and reduce Mac CPU usage. For one, you can use the built-in Activity Monitor tool. It allows you to track the load in real time in detail. To reduce Mac CPU usage, pay attention to background processes. They can consume significant resources. If any applications are using too much CPU, close or restart them. Also, keep your operating system and software up to date.


Tools for Monitoring CPU Performance

And what is CPU usage on a computer? Monitoring CPU usage on a computer is key if you want to maintain consistent performance. Modern operating systems have built-in tools for such monitoring. However, there are also third-party solutions. The latter provide more detailed analytics. They also allow you to optimize your processor’s performance.

Tools for Linux

Linux has several powerful tools for CPU monitoring. In particular, top, htop, and glances. These utilities allow you to get detailed information about usage:

  • RAM,
  • CPU,
  • and other system resources.

They are especially popular among system administrators and users who need a deeper analysis of performance.

Windows Task Manager

It is one of the most popular monitoring tools and shows which processes load the CPU the most and how many resources are used in real time. With Task Manager, users can:

  • analyze system processes,
  • disable unnecessary programs,
  • reduce the load on the CPU if necessary.

Third-party programs

In addition to built-in solutions, there are third-party programs. They offer additional monitoring features.

  • Microsoft’s Process Explorer provides users with a deeper dive into CPU utilization analysis, as it can detect even the most invisible processes that can affect system performance.
  • HWMonitor allows you to monitor the temperature of the processor and other parameters that affect its operation.

 Image Credit: Depositphoto.

Techniques for Maintaining Maximum Performance

To achieve consistently high computer performance, do more than just monitor your computer; you should also take steps to optimize it. There are several strategies for doing so.

Upgrade your hardware

Over time, even the most powerful processors are not fast enough for the demands of modern tasks. Therefore, it is advisable to consider hardware upgrades, in particular:

  • upgrading the processor,
  • adding more RAM, 
  • paying attention to the cooling system.

For example, overheating of the processor in many cases reduces its efficiency, so it is important to ensure high-quality cooling with the help of liquid cooling systems or fans.

Optimize your settings

An essential step to optimizing CPU performance is to tune your software. Often, programs use more resources than necessary. This is the result of incorrect settings and insufficient optimization.

Therefore, reducing the number of programs that run when the system boots will significantly reduce CPU usage.

Power Settings will allow you to optimize CPU usage depending on the workload.

Regular system maintenance

This includes:

  • cleaning from dust, 
  • updating drivers and software, 
  • scanning for malware,
  • regular use of anti-virus software.

The latter will help protect the system from malicious programs that can use processor resources unnoticed.


If you want to have stable computer performance, you need to understand what CPU usage is and how to optimize it. You can detect problems and take measures to solve them by using appropriate tools for monitoring and analyzing CPU performance. And to maintain maximum performance under high loads, you can upgrade your hardware and perform regular system maintenance. Regardless of what you use, there are various solutions for monitoring and optimizing CPU usage on a computer. They will help you improve system performance and maximize efficiency in your work.

Leave a Reply

Your email address will not be published. Required fields are marked *